India`s new rule requires all electronic devices to use USB-C ports, Apple may face the dilemma of changing ports for older iPhones

The Indian government recently issued a new regulation, requiring all electronic devices sold in India, regardless of when they were produced, to use USB Type-C ports for charging, and this regulation will take effect in June 2025. This regulation is similar to the common charger rule that the EU had previously formulated, but more stringent, because it applies not only to newly produced devices, but also to old ones. Saudi Arabia has announced its decision to standardize the charging ports of all electronic devices to USB-C

Starting from January 1, 2025, Saudi Arabia will implement a new regulation that requires all electronic devices sold in the country to use USB C interface as the charging port. This regulation aims to improve the user experience of consumers, reduce costs and electronic waste, and enhance the quality of data transfer. What is the function of the E-Marker chip in the USB Type-c data cable?

In order to standardize the function and electrical performance of Usb Type-c data lines, USB-IF has set a hardware threshold: if you want to achieve 5A current, 3.0 transmission, and video output functions, you must use an E-Marker chip. What is Thunderbolt, and how is it different from USB-C?

What is Thunderbolt, and how is it different from USB-C? Thunderbolt is a hardware interface technology developed by Intel and Apple, which allows you to connect your computer and various external devices, such as monitors, hard drives, speakers, etc., with a single cable. The feature of Thunderbolt is that it can transmit both PCI Express (PCIe) and DisplayPort (DP) signals at the same time, and also provide direct current power, which can reduce the number and mess of cables. What is the difference between USB 3.0, 3.1 and 3.2?

USB is a universal standard that is ubiquitous. But on newer devices, there is some confusion between the versions of USB 3.0, 3.1 and 3.2. This confusion stems mainly from the USB-IF (USB Implementers Forum, the governing body behind the USB standard) renaming older standards under newer specifications. This resulted in some names that consumers find hard to understand. EU Demands Uniform Adoption of USB-C Charging Interface for Electronic Devices; Apple Confirms USB-C Integration Starting from iPhone 15

In a significant move towards standardization, the European Union (EU) has announced a requirement for all electronic devices, including smartphones, tablets, and digital cameras, sold within the EU to adopt the Type-C charging interface starting from 2024. This mandate, effective from 2026, will extend to larger electronic products such as laptops. The decision was made on October 24, 2022, in accordance with EU regulations.
